<p>Our <strong>mind</strong> can be our best<strong> friend or</strong> our worst<strong> enemy</strong>. It all depends on how we are programmed.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>Our<strong> basic</strong> belief systems, or our <strong>programming</strong>, is <strong>set</strong> by the time we are three to five years old. Of course we continue to<strong> learn</strong> for years and hopefully <strong>all our</strong> <strong>lives</strong> yet <strong>none</strong> of this learning will <strong>change</strong> our basic<strong> belief</strong> system. Whatever was<strong> going</strong> <strong>on</strong> in our <strong>family</strong> dynamic when we were growing up <strong>sets</strong> the<strong> stage</strong> for how we will live the<strong> rest</strong> of our <strong>lives</strong>. This includes <strong>behaviors</strong> and <strong>habits</strong> that anyone who has tried <strong>to change</strong> them knows are very <strong>ingrained</strong> into who we are.</p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>Habits</strong> and patterns of behavior are <strong>hard</strong> wired synaptic <strong>memory</strong> loops in your<strong> brain</strong> that respond to<strong> sensory</strong> stimulus. This means when you<strong> encounter</strong> an event,<strong> sight</strong>,<strong> sound</strong>, whatever, in order to <strong>respond</strong> to this, a message goes from your senses to your <strong>brain</strong> finding a reference to know how to <strong>react</strong>. This is why <strong>people</strong> will keep <strong>reacting</strong> the same way <strong>to triggers</strong> in their lives and <strong>feel powerless</strong> to change it.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Does this mean we are <strong>doomed</strong> to be the way we were <strong>programmed</strong> to be by <strong>influences</strong> outside of who we really are? <strong>NO WAY!</strong></p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>Meditation</strong> is the key to <strong>settling</strong> the mind down, for if it stays very<strong> active</strong> it will not give up the <strong>control</strong> it has over us. It is known that <strong>during</strong> times of great<strong> stress</strong> people will go into <strong>patterns</strong> and <strong>habits</strong> of their<strong> basic belief systems</strong>. Meditation <strong>reduces stress</strong> and opens the door of the <strong>subconscious</strong> mind where we can develop<strong> sub-belief systems</strong>.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>We<strong> create</strong> sub-belief systems that we can <strong>reference</strong> to deal with various<strong> events</strong> in our lives. Once set we have a <strong>choice</strong> of how to react to the<strong> triggers</strong> that would have normally pushed us into the<strong> old patterns</strong> and habits. The more we consciously <strong>choose</strong> the sub-belief systems the more they <strong>become</strong> the default<strong> setting</strong>. Sub-belief <strong>systems</strong> are formed and <strong>maintained</strong> in the <strong>subconscious</strong> mind and <strong>meditation</strong> is how we arrive there.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>The more you<strong> use</strong> these synaptic memory <strong>loops</strong>, the more <strong>established</strong> they become. If you <strong>stop using </strong>them they will eventually <strong>disconnect</strong>. This means that with effort you can <strong>change</strong> anything about your <strong>patterns and habits</strong> that you do not like.
